Positive surge propagating in an asymmetrical canal
Journal of Hydro-environment Research ( IF 2.4 ) Pub Date : 2020-05-07 , DOI: 10.1016/j.jher.2020.04.002
Urvisha Kiri , Xinqian Leng , Hubert Chanson

A positive surge is an unsteady open channel flow motion characterised by a sudden rise in water surface elevation. The literature is focused primarily on rectangular channels. Herein, the free-surface features of positive surges propagating upstream were investigated in an asymmetrical canal. The surge propagation was a three-dimensional unsteady flow motion, resulting in a complicated transient secondary motion compared to positive surge propagating in rectangular canals. The present results may be relevant to surge propagation in man-made trapezoidal canals and natural irregular-shaped channels.
